read the sources given below and answer the following questions that follow source necessity:- party system is not something any country can choose it evolves over a long time depending on the nature of society its social and regional divisions its history of politics and is system of elections this cannot be changed very quickly each country develops a party system that is conditioned by special circumstances. souces B challenges to the political parties. we have seen how crucial political parties are for the working of democracy since parties are the most visible face of democracy it is natural that people blame parties for whatever is wrong with the working of democracy all over the world people expect strong dissatisfaction with the failure of political parties to perform the functions well this is the case in our country to popular dissatisfaction and criticism have focused on 4 problem areas in the working of political parties need to face and overcome the challenges in order to remain effective instruments of democracy. souce C how can political parties be reformed. in order to face these challenges political parties need to be reformed the question is a political parties willing to reform if they are willing what has prevented them from reforming so far if they are not willing is it possible to force them to reform citizens all over the world face this question this is not a simple question to answer in a democracy the final decision is made by leaders who represent political parties people can replace them but only by another set of party leaders. 1) why has India evolved a multi party system? 2) identify the most serious challenges faced by the political parties in India? 3) highlight any one suggestion to reform political parties and its leaders?
